We Take A Look At Some Of These Home-based Cleaning Methods: Aluminum Foil Take a small bowl, line it up with aluminum foil, and then fill it with hot water and add 1 tablespoon of laundry detergent (bleach-free). Soak your jewelry item for about one minute in the bowl and then rinse well and let it air-dry. This ion exchange process will make your jewelry shiny again, like a new one. Baking Soda Baking soda is a perfect cleaning agent for silver jewelry items which is starting to show tarnish. Add ¼ cup baking soda powder and 2 tablespoons of water to make a paste.
